Early withdrawal and non-withdrawal death in the months following hemodialysis initiation: A retrospective cohort analysis
Hemodialysis International Feb 15, 2019
Wetmore JB, et al. - In this retrospective cohort analysis, researchers investigated the difference between factors associated with elective hemodialysis withdrawal and those associated with non-withdrawal death soon after maintenance hemodialysis initiation. Using data from the United States Renal Data System (USRDS) from 2011 to 2014, they identified advanced age and white, as opposed to black, race to have the most strong association with early elective hemodialysis withdrawal compared with non-withdrawal death. However, it remains challenging to differentiate between patients who will experience early withdrawal vs non-withdrawal death, as many factors are similarly associated with both outcomes.
